Android Studio生成签名无法读取密钥

时间:2018-04-04 11:23:32

标签: android gradle android-keystore apktool

我的密钥库遇到了一个非常严重的问题,但未能解决它。

我正在使用:

-androind studio 3.0.1 
-gradle:3.0.1
-distributions/gradle-4.1-all.zip

由于某些原因,当我尝试 Build> Generate Signed Apk...

我正在

Error:Execution failed for task :app:packageProductionRelease. Failed to read key myKey from store "C:\Users\abc\Documents\bucket\mm\keystore": Keystore was tampered with, or password was incorrect

我尝试过使用终端

keytool -list -v -keystore "keystore.jks" -alias myKey -storepass pass -keypass pass 它显示了键的属性。所以我很确定密码是正确的,密钥库没有损坏。

是否有其他方法或解决方案可以解决此问题?

非常感谢您的帮助。

1 个答案:

答案 0 :(得分:0)

如果有人遇到类似的问题。显然密钥库确实存在问题。将其替换为与之相同的密钥库的旧副本后。